[feat]: add new sample multirpc
diff --git a/multirpc/go-client/cmd/main.go b/multirpc/go-client/cmd/main.go
index 7e0f237..d87a442 100644
--- a/multirpc/go-client/cmd/main.go
+++ b/multirpc/go-client/cmd/main.go
@@ -38,7 +38,7 @@
if err != nil {
panic(err)
}
- err = nil
+
cli, err := ins.NewClient(
client.WithClientProtocolTriple())
if err != nil {
@@ -70,9 +70,8 @@
if err != nil {
panic(err)
}
- err = nil
var respDubbo string
- if err := connDubbo.CallUnary(context.Background(), []interface{}{"hello", "new", "dubbo"}, &respDubbo, "SayHello"); err != nil {
+ if err = connDubbo.CallUnary(context.Background(), []interface{}{"hello", "new", "dubbo"}, &respDubbo, "SayHello"); err != nil {
logger.Errorf("GreetProvider.Greet err: %s", err)
return
}
diff --git a/multirpc/go-server/cmd/main.go b/multirpc/go-server/cmd/main.go
index 672390e..6b78ec8 100644
--- a/multirpc/go-server/cmd/main.go
+++ b/multirpc/go-server/cmd/main.go
@@ -72,10 +72,9 @@
// 利用生成代码注册业务逻辑(GreetTripleServer)
// service配置,可以在此处覆盖server注入的默认配置
// 若观察RegisterGreetServiceHandler的代码,会发现本质上是调用Server.Register
- if err := greet.RegisterGreetServiceHandler(srv, &GreetMultiRPCServer{}); err != nil {
+ if err = greet.RegisterGreetServiceHandler(srv, &GreetMultiRPCServer{}); err != nil {
panic(err)
}
- err = nil
// 运行
if err := srv.Serve(); err != nil {
logger.Error(err)
@@ -106,12 +105,12 @@
if err != nil {
panic(err)
}
- if err := srvDubbo.Register(&GreetProvider{}, nil, server.WithInterface("GreetProvider")); err != nil {
+ if err = srvDubbo.Register(&GreetProvider{}, nil, server.WithInterface("GreetProvider")); err != nil {
panic(err)
}
// 运行
- if err := srvDubbo.Serve(); err != nil {
+ if err = srvDubbo.Serve(); err != nil {
logger.Error(err)
}
@@ -140,7 +139,7 @@
if err != nil {
panic(err)
}
- if err := srvJsonRpc.Register(&GreetProvider{}, nil, server.WithInterface("GreetProvider")); err != nil {
+ if err = srvJsonRpc.Register(&GreetProvider{}, nil, server.WithInterface("GreetProvider")); err != nil {
panic(err)
}